Walters, et New Yerk, agest for a Weal Virginia oeal land syndicate, arrived in Bralnerd, Minn., en Wednesday aocem- paaled by Jehn Williams, of Broekvule, Ma, and identified William Williams, a market gardener, aa Jebn'a brother, and a 1 jng leat heir te a large Weat Virginia es tate. Tba property la la Pewell'a Vallev, twenty-five mlltt from Oamberland Gap. It waa devastated by the war, and tba family broken up and eeattered. William enured the Union army, while hU bretberserved In the Southern army. In tba battle el Perry Title, one made a prisoner of bia brother. There waa bltlernea between them, and William, when tba war waa ever, did net go borne, bnteame North, and waa reported killed in tba Wisconsin lumber weeds. The net of tba family moved te Mieaenrl and prospered. Tba old bemeatead turned out te be ever an Immenaa oeal bad, and a ayadleata bunted up tba helra and gave a big prlee for tba property, Proof waa wanted of Wllllam'a death, and a March therefer resulted In bla being found In Bralnerd.
